6  Super Meat Boy / Meat Helping / Re: Xbox exclusive characters' abilities? on: February 13, 2011, 06:01:12 AM
Gish, who sticks to walls and ceilings.

Alien Homonid, who has a blaster to slow his descent.

Tim from Braid, reverses time. Useful for some of the bandages suspended over pits with no other way of escape than a double jump.

Spelunky, who can propel himself forward mostly uncontrollably.

Pink Knight, (from Castle Crashers) not really sure what this character does.

The Ninja from N+, very fast running, floaty and slow jump
